N.J.S.A. 34:1-69.14

Oath

34:1-69.14. Oath Every appointed interpreter before entering upon his duties, shall take an oath that he will make a true interpretation in an understandable manner to the person for whom he is appointed and that he will repeat the statements of the person in the English language to the best of his skill and judgment. L.1983, c. 564, s. 8, eff. Jan. 17, 1984.
